TERMINAL EXERCISES

1. Define biodiversity. Mention its three levels and briefly explain them.

Answer: Biodiversity is the term given to the variety of organisms that live on Earth.

Biodiversity has three levels:

(i) Genetic diversity: variation in genes among individuals of the same species.

(ii) Species diversity: variety of different species present in a particular area.

(iii) Ecosystem diversity: variety of ecosystems such as forests, grasslands, deserts and aquatic ecosystems present on Earth.

2. What are the global and Indian patterns of biodiversity? What do you mean by a 'hot spot' of diversity?

Answer: Biodiversity is not distributed equally across the world. Generally, it is richer in tropical regions and decreases towards the poles. Countries near the equator have greater biodiversity because of favourable climate conditions. India is one of the world’s megadiverse countries and has rich biodiversity due to variations in climate, landforms and ecosystems.

A hot spot of diversity is a region with very high biodiversity and a large number of endemic species (species found only in that region) that is under threat from human activities and habitat loss. In India, the Western Ghats and the Eastern Himalayas are important biodiversity hot spots.

3. Name the three domains of life and state one distinguishing features of each.

Answer: The three domains of life are:

(i) Archaebacteria are thermophilic or heat loving bacteria that live in high temperature vents.

(ii) Eubacteria are single celled organisms without well developed nucleus.

(iii) Eukarya are all other organisms with a well formed nucleus in their cell/cells.

4. Name the five kingdoms of life and state one feature of each of the kingdoms which differs from that of the others.

Answer: The five kingdoms of life are:

(i) Monera: Organisms are unicellular and prokaryotic (without a true nucleus).

(ii) Protista: Organisms are mostly unicellular and eukaryotic (with a true nucleus).

(iii) Fungi: Organisms do not have chlorophyll and obtain food by absorption.

(iv) Plantae: Organisms contain chlorophyll and make their own food by photosynthesis.

(v) Animalia: Organisms cannot make their own food and show movement (locomotion).

5. Give an account of the classification of Kingdom Plantae into its divisions. Cite examples.

Answer: Kingdom Plantae is classified into the following divisions:

(i) Thallophyta – Plant body is not differentiated into root, stem and leaves. These are simple plants.
Example: Algae (Spirogyra).

(ii) Bryophyta – Small plants with no true roots, stems and leaves. They usually grow in moist places.
Example: Moss (Funaria).

(iii) Pteridophyta – Plants have true roots, stems and leaves and reproduce through spores.
Example: Fern (Pteris).

(iv) Gymnosperms – Seed-producing plants with naked seeds (not enclosed in fruits).
Example: Pine (Pinus).

(v) Angiosperms – Flowering plants with seeds enclosed within fruits.
Example: Mango, wheat, rose.

8. To which class of chordates do the following belong? Justify your inclusion into the class by stating any one characteristic feature. Crow, lion, cobra, flying frog, shark, fresh water fish.

Answer:

Animal

Class

One Characteristic Feature

Crow

Aves (Birds)

Body is covered with feathers, and they are warm-blooded (endothermic).

Lion

Mammalia (Mammals)

They have mammary glands to nourish their young and have hair on their bodies.

Cobra

Reptilia (Reptiles)

Their skin is dry and covered with scales; they breathe through lungs.

Flying frog

Amphibia (Amphibians)

Their skin is smooth, moist, and without scales. They often have a larval stage (tadpole) in water.

Shark

Chondrichthyes (Cartilaginous Fish)

Their endoskeleton is made entirely of cartilage, not bone.

Fresh water fish

Osteichthyes (Bony Fish)

They have a skeleton made of bone. They also have an operculum (a bony cover) over their gills.

9. Write three sentences on why we need to classify and give scientific names to organisms.

Answer: We need to classify organisms and give them scientific names for the following reasons:

(i) Classification helps us study and understand the vast variety of living organisms in a systematic way.

(ii) Scientific names provide a unique and universal name for each organism, avoiding confusion caused by different local names.

(iii) Classification helps us identify organisms and understand their similarities, differences and evolutionary relationships.

10. Why does biodiversity need to be conserved?

Answer: Biodiversity needs to be conserved because:

(i) It helps maintain the ecological balance and stability of ecosystems.

(ii) It provides important resources such as food, medicines, fuel and raw materials.

(iii) Conservation prevents the extinction of species and protects natural heritage for future generations.

11. State three ways by which biodiversity may be conserved?

Answer: Three ways by which biodiversity may be conserved are:

(i) Protection of natural habitats by establishing national parks, wildlife sanctuaries and biosphere reserves.

(ii) Preventing overexploitation of plants and animals through controlled use of natural resources.

(iii) Afforestation and reforestation to increase green cover and restore damaged ecosystems.
